The current dress uniform of the Welsh Guards features a distinctive scarlet tunic with dark blue trousers and a white belt. The uniform is complemented by a bearskin hat, which is worn during ceremonial duties. The tunic is adorned with the distinctive Welsh Guards insignia, and the soldiers typically wear black boots. Overall, the uniform reflects the regiment's rich heritage and ceremonial role within the British Army.

Guards wear bearskin hats as part of their uniform for ceremonial purposes and to symbolize their role as protectors of the royal family and important buildings in the United Kingdom. The hats have been a traditional part of the uniform since the early 19th century and are meant to convey a sense of authority and tradition.
